What is Timeskip YouTube Dislike Viewer?
The Timeskip YouTube Dislike Viewer is a free, web-based utility that estimates the number of dislikes on any public YouTube video using data from the Return YouTube Dislike project—an open-source community initiative that aggregates historical and real-time engagement patterns. By entering a video URL, users instantly see:
- Estimated like count
- Estimated dislike count
- Like-to-dislike ratio (as a percentage)
This tool works on desktop and mobile, requires no installation, and delivers results in under five seconds.

Q5: Why did YouTube hide dislikes?
YouTube removed public dislike counts in December 2021 to reduce targeted harassment and “dislike bombing,” especially against marginalized creators. However, dislikes are still recorded privately and visible to video owners.
